Silent Mode

There may be times when you need to silence your phone entirely. The
phone’s Silent Mode allows you to mute all sounds without turning your
phone off.

To change your phone’s Silent Mode:

1.

From the Standby mode, press

to display the main menu.

2.

Highlight

Settings

and press

.

3.

Highlight

Sounds

and press

.

4.

Highlight

Ringer/Key Vol.

and press

.

5.

Select the menu under

Ringer Volume

and press

.

6.

Highlight

Silence All

and press

.

Tip:

When Ringer Volume is set as Silence All, other items are changed

to Off and cannot be highlighted by cursor.

Changing the Greeting

The greeting can be up to 15 characters and is displayed on the first line of
your phone’s display screen in Standby mode.

To change your greeting:

1.

From the Standby mode, press

to display the main menu.

2.

Highlight

Settings

and press

.

3.

Highlight

Display

and press

.

4.

Highlight

Greeting

and press

.

5.

Select either

Username

or

Custom

and press

.

Username

to display the username when you are signed in.

Custom

to customize the greeting by entering characters (Press

to erase single character, press and hold

to erase entire entry. See

pages 78-82 for the entering method.)

6.

Press .

Note:

When Calendar or Screen Saver is set for StandbyDisplay, greeting is

not displayed.

Alert Notification

Your phone comes with several different options to keep you aware of
what’s going on by sounding the alert or ringer.

Services

sets alert On or Off for network services parameter changes.

Voicemail

sets alert to notify you of caller’s message(s).

Messaging

sets alert to notify you of text message(s).

Minute Beep

sets a minute reminder that beeps ten seconds before the

end of each minute during a call.

Signal Fade

sets alert to notify you when your phone loses a signal

during a call.

To set the alerts:

1.

From the Standby mode, press

to display the main menu.

2.

Highlight

Settings

and press

.

3.

Highlight

Sounds

and press

.

4.

Highlight

Alerts

and press

.

5.

Highlight your desired option and press

.

6.

If you selected

Services

,

Minute Beep

or

Signal Fade

, select

On

or

Off

.

If you selected

Voicemail

or

Messaging

, select

Once

,

Repeat Alert

or

Off

.

Tip: Repeat Alert

sounds every two minutes for twenty minutes.
